Hey Tomas — handing off the hot-reload work on Glintworks' config service before I'm out. The watcher now debounces file events (300ms) and validates against the schema before swapping the live struct, so no more half-applied configs. Review focus: the atomic pointer swap in `reloader.go` and the rollback path when validation fails. Tests are in `reload_test.go`. To decrypt the staging config bundle for local testing, use the passphrase that follows.

unlock words, fafop-hawep: briwyn-oliix-sorox

CI note: Paylane integration tests flake on the settlement suite. Root cause: the mock ledger container sometimes boots slower than the 5s health check. Do not bump retries again — it masks real timeouts. Fix is pinning the ledger image and raising the health window to 15s; done on the torrent-fix branch. If you see a red run on main, re-run once only, then check container boot logs before blaming the test. The last known-good run is identified by the trace token below.

pipeline stamp: htk31_f769b577b3028a4e9958e5bb8d1259a

**Ticket: Glyphbill PDF renderer clips footer on A5.** Hey plugin folks — if your invoice templates target A5, heads up: the footer band gets clipped by about 6mm when a custom margin hook is registered. Looks like our layout pass applies your margins after pagination instead of before. We're shipping a fix in the next Glyphbill point release; until then, pad your footer manually. Grab the patched build using the token below.

build token for tawip-yageg: htk9_92ac43d42

### Step 4 — Vendoring Fonts for the Lanternleaf Release

Before cutting the build, sync the third-party fonts into `vendor/fonts` using the fetch script — don't grab them by hand, licensing metadata matters. The bundler signs the vendored set so CI can verify nothing drifted. To sign locally, use the release key shown just below.

deploy key for yajop-fahop: bky3_h1v